> Can QGIS import a gdb file and allow a user to transform it to kml/kmz
for export and re-use? I didn't see anything to this end within the user
documentation

Definitely - I do this all the time! Just open the gdb data source (eg drag
and drop it in QGIS), then right click the layer and select "save as". You
can then change the output format from that dialog to KML or kmz.
